Rave and Festival Identity Studies

RBG focuses on identity shaped through rave participation — fashion, movement, group dynamics, and the sensory environment of large-scale events.

Department Overview

RBG runs from a participation-and-ritual seminar, into a fits-and-aesthetic studio, into a capstone field study built around two approved live events. EDM is a sister department — students often double-major or cross-register.
